Matt Van Winkle In-Store!

Tonight we have the Matt Van Winkle Band performing in our loft at 7PM! Los Angeles natives (Topanga to be exact), Matt Van Winkle & his band have been making music on and off since 2006. His newest album, Sunshine National Dust, sees Matt & co. exploring new intricacies of their warm, emotive sound alongside lyrics of home, love and vulnerability. First off, at 7PM, we're gonna be premiering Drive By Truckers' newest record English Oceans (ATO Records) before its release next Tuesday! Now the 12th release by these Georgia natives, English Oceans an elegantly balanced and deeply engaged new effort that finds the group refreshed and firing on all cylinders. Running the gamut from "chainsaw rock 'n' roll to very delicate, pretty-sounding stuff," English Oceans looks poised to further the band's already stellar recording history, and we couldn't be more thrilled to spin it for you before its release!
